• DocumentCode
    2345045
  • Title

    WS-Policy based Monitoring of Composite Web Services

  • Author

    Erradi, Abdelkarim ; Maheshwari, Piyush ; Tosic, Vladimir

  • fYear
    2007
  • fDate
    26-28 Nov. 2007
  • Firstpage
    99
  • Lastpage
    108
  • Abstract
    MASC (Manageable and Adaptive Service Compositions)1* is a policy-based middleware for monitoring and control of composite Web services execution. The monitorable requirements are specified in the WS-Policy4MASC language that extends WS-Policy by defining new types of monitoring and control policy assertions. This paper focuses on MASC monitoring capabilities to detect business exceptions and runtime faults. Our solutions are complementary to the existing approaches and provide: synchronous and asynchronous monitoring both at the SOAP messaging layer and the process orchestration layer, greater diversity of monitoring and control constructs, as well as the externalization of monitoring and adaptation actions from definitions of business processes. We implemented a MASC proof-of-concept prototype and evaluated it on monitoring and adaptation scenarios from a stock trading case study. Our performance studies indicate that MASC overhead and scalability are acceptable.
  • Keywords
    Adaptive control; Fault detection; Middleware; Monitoring; Programmable control; Prototypes; Runtime; Scalability; Simple object access protocol; Web services;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Web Services, 2007. ECOWS '07. Fifth European Conference on
  • Conference_Location
    Halle, Germany
  • Print_ISBN
    978-0-7695-3044-4
  • Type

    conf

  • DOI
    10.1109/ECOWS.2007.31
  • Filename
    4399739